What Is a Digital Air Fryer?
A digital air fryer uses a fan and hot air to cook food fast. It gives you that crispy, fried texture without a deep fryer full of oil. Most models use touch screens instead of dials, which makes cooking simpler.
Basic air fryers just heat and blow hot air. A best digital air fryer oven adds extra tools like bake, roast, broil, dehydrate, and reheat settings. Some even add a rotisserie spit for whole chickens.
Here are the main tech types you’ll see in this guide:
- Rapid air circulation: A strong fan pushes hot air around your food fast.
- Turbo or Hi-Fry boost: A short blast of extra heat at the end for a crispier finish.
- Multi-function ovens: These work like a small convection oven with air fry built in.
Picking the right type comes down to how much space you have and how many people you cook for.

Key Features to Compare Before Buying a Best Digital Air Fryer
When you shop for a best digital air fryer, start with capacity and size. A tiny 2-quart unit won’t feed a family of four. A 12-quart oven might take up too much counter space for a small kitchen.
Next, check the core technology. Some models use plain rapid air. Others add turbo fans or a Hi-Fry boost for extra crunch. Safety matters too. Look for auto shutoff, safety certifications, and cool-touch handles.
Check the build quality. Ceramic and stainless steel baskets tend to last longer than basic nonstick coatings. Easy controls also matter. A clear touch screen with simple presets beats a confusing dial any day.
Don’t skip cleaning needs. Dishwasher-safe parts save real time each week. Finally, weigh the price against the warranty. A slightly pricier best digital air fryer oven with a two-year warranty can be worth more than a cheap model with no support at all.

How to Choose the Best Digital Air Fryer
Picking the right model starts with a few honest questions about your kitchen and your cooking habits.
- Size and capacity: Small households do fine with 2 to 4 quarts. Bigger families need 6 quarts or more.
- Technology type: Basic rapid air works for most meals. Turbo or Hi-Fry modes add extra crisping power.
- Performance and precision: A wider temperature range gives you more control over delicate or hearty dishes.
- Available modes: More presets mean less guesswork, especially for beginners.
- Build and materials: Ceramic and stainless steel tend to outlast basic nonstick coatings.
- Ease of cleaning: Dishwasher-safe parts save time every single week.
- Brand reliability: Established brands often back products with stronger warranties.
- Price versus value: The cheapest option isn’t always the smartest long-term buy.

Frequently Asked Questions
What makes a digital air fryer different from basic models?
Digital models use touch screens and presets instead of manual dials. This makes cooking times and temperatures far more precise.
Is one brand clearly better than another?
Not really. Each brand has strengths, so the best digital air fryer for you depends on your household size and cooking habits.
How long does a digital air fryer typically last?
Most well-built models last three to five years with regular use. Ceramic and stainless steel parts tend to hold up longer than basic coatings.
What size do I need for a family of four?
A 6-quart basket or larger usually works well for a family of four. Larger ovens like our 10 to 12-quart picks give you even more room.
Can beginners use these easily?
Yes. Most digital models come with simple presets, so you just pick a setting and press start.
Is it worth paying more for a premium pick?
If you want extra functions, larger capacity, or a wider temperature range, spending more can be worth it. For simple daily cooking, a mid-range best digital air fryer often does the job just fine.
